Kraken Expands with Acquisition of Bitnomial
Leading cryptocurrency exchange Kraken has made a significant move in the derivatives market by agreeing to acquire Bitnomial in a deal worth up to $550 million. The acquisition, expected to close by June, marks a strategic step for Kraken in enhancing its offerings in the digital assets space.
Bitnomial: Pioneering in U.S. Derivatives Market
Bitnomial, known as the first crypto-native business in the U.S. to hold all three Commodity Futures Trading Commission-issued licenses required to operate an exchange, a clearinghouse, and a brokerage, has been at the forefront of revolutionizing the derivatives landscape. The company’s commitment to digital-asset-native solutions aligns well with Kraken’s vision of advancing the future of finance.
“The shape of a market is determined by its clearing infrastructure, and the U.S. has had no clearing infrastructure built for digital assets,” stated Kraken co-CEO Arjun Sethi. “Bitnomial spent a decade building capabilities that cannot be retrofitted onto legacy systems. That is the regulated foundation we are adding, starting with spot margin, perpetuals, and options for US clients under CFTC regulation,” Sethi added.
Kraken’s Strategic Acquisitions
The acquisition of Bitnomial adds to Kraken’s series of strategic moves in the derivatives and digital assets space. With previous acquisitions of firms like NinjaTrader, Capitalise.ai, Breakout, Small Exchange, and Backed, Kraken has been expanding its portfolio to offer a comprehensive suite of financial products to its clients.
More recently, Kraken made headlines by becoming the first crypto firm to receive a master account with the Federal Reserve, signaling its growing influence in the traditional financial ecosystem. The company has also filed confidentially for an initial public offering, underlining its ambitions for further growth and expansion.
Driving Innovation in Financial Markets
The collaboration between Kraken and Bitnomial is poised to create new opportunities for partners, including fintechs, banks, brokerages, and payment providers, to offer regulated U.S. derivatives products to their customers. By combining their expertise and resources, the companies aim to introduce innovative products and services that cater to the evolving needs of the market.
Looking ahead, Bitnomial envisions a future that includes crypto-settled products, tokenized assets, and capital-efficient contracts that have the potential to transform global markets.
